How Our Team Handles Basement Water Removal

The key to successful water removal is a well-planned and executed process. Our team follows a step-by-step approach to ensure that your basement is thoroughly dried, cleaned, and restored. We understand that every minute counts, which is why we work efficiently to reduce downtime and get your home back to normal. Our process includes:

Initial Assessment

Our team arrives quickly to assess the situation and identify the source of the leak. We'll also take moisture readings to find out the extent of the damage.

Water Removal

We'll use industrial-grade pumps to extract water from the affected area. Our team will also use air movers to speed up evaporation and reduce drying time.

Structural Drying

We use specialized equipment, such as desiccants and dehumidifiers to dry out the structure and prevent further damage. Our team will also monitor moisture levels to ensure the area is completely dry.

Sanitizing and Reconstruction

We thoroughly clean and disinfect the affected area to prevent mold growth. Our team will then repair and restore any damaged structures, ensuring your home is safe and secure.

Final Inspection

Our team will conduct a final visual inspection to ensure the job is complete and your basement is safe to occupy.

Warning Signs You Need Basement Water Removal

Don't wait until it's too late, addressing water damage quickly can save you thousands of dollars in repairs. Keep an eye out for these warning signs:

Musty Odors That Won't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ors in your basement could be a sign of mold growth. If left unchecked, it can spread and cause serious health problems. Don't ignore the smell address it quickly.

Water Stains on the Ceiling

Water stains on your ceiling or walls can show a leak or flood. If left untreated, it can cause structural damage and electric shock. Act quickly to prevent further damage.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of excessive moisture. This can lead to structural damage and displacement of household items. Don't delay call us today.

Water Pooling Around the Foundation

Water pooling around your home's foundation can show a leak or crack. This can lead to serious structural damage and expensive repairs. Address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of excessive moisture. This can lead to rot and decay of the surrounding structure. Don't ignore the warning signs.

Water-Saturated Drywall

Water-saturated drywall can be a sign of a leak or flood. If left untreated, it can cause structural damage and electrical issues. Act quickly to prevent further damage.

Basement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Pro

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ak in a corner of the basement Yes No You can likely handle a small leak on your own with some basic materials and tools.
Flooding due to a burst pipe No Yes A burst pipe needs specialized equipment and expertise to safely and effectively handle the water and prevent further damage.
Water damage to a crawl space No Yes Crawl spaces are difficult to access and need specialized equipment to safely and effectively dry and clean.
Water damage due to a natural disaster No Yes Natural disasters need specialized expertise and equipment to safely and effectively handle the damage and prevent further issues.
Water damage to a finished basement No Yes Finished basements need specialized equipment and expertise to safely and effectively restore the area and prevent damage to the finishes.
Water damage to a structural element of the home No Yes Structural damage needs immediate attention and specialized expertise to prevent further damage and ensure the safety of the home and its occupants.

Basement Water Removal Cost in Montgomery Village, MD

The cost of basement water removal can vary greatly dep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in the Montgomery Village, MD area.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services related to basement water removal: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water removal and extraction $500 - $2,500 The extent of the water damage, the size of the affected area, and the type of equipment needed.
Structural drying and moisture control $1,000 - $5,000 The size of the affected area, the type of materials used, and the complexity of the job.
Sanitizing and deodorizing $500 - $2,000 The size of the affected area, the type of materials used, and the level of contamination.
Reconstruction and repair $2,000 - $10,000 The extent of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the type of materials used.
Final inspection and report $200 - $1,000 The complexity of the job and the type of inspection required.

Common Questions About Basement Water Removal

Q: What is the average cost of basement water removal?

A: The cost of basement water removal can vary greatly dep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. But, on average, you can expect to pay between $500 and $5,000 for water removal and extraction, $1,000 to $5,000 for structural drying and moisture control, and $2,000 to $10,000 for reconstruction and repair.

Q: How long does it take to dry out a basement?

A: The time it takes to dry out a basement depends on the extent of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the type of equipment used. But, on average, it can take anywhere from a few days to a week or more to dry out a basement completely.

Q: Can I use a wet/dry vacuum to remove water from my basement?

A: While a wet/dry vacuum can be useful for small water spills, it's not effective for large-scale water removal. In fact, using a wet/dry vacuum can even spread the water and make the problem worse. It's best to call a professional for basement water removal.

Q: What is the difference between water removal and water damage restoration?

A: Water removal refers to the process of extracting water from the affected area, while water damage restoration refers to the process of repairing and restoring the damaged structure and contents. Both services are crucial to ensuring your home is safe and secure.
